Opening Ceremony of the 2026 South Africa Investment Conference
South Africa hosts its 6th Investment Conference against the backdrop of the twin shocks of the Iran War and worsening geoeconomic fractures. Launched in 2018 by President Cyril Ramaphosa the initiative has netted the economy over 600 billion rand that has helped build new factories, mines and industries.
